openSUSE Leap 42.3 - 2018:2479-1 Important: Ceph DoS and Header Crash

An update that solves two vulnerabilities and has 21 fixes is now available.. openSUSE Security Update: Security update for ceph ______________________________________________________________________________ Announcement ID: openSUSE-SU-2018:2479-1 Rating: important References: #1051598 #1054061 #1056125 #1056967 #1059458 #1060904 #1061461 #1063014 #1066182 #1066502 #1067088 #1067119 #1067705 #1070357 #1071386 #1074301 #1079076 #1080788 #1081379 #1081600 #1086340 #1087269 #1087493 Cross-References: CVE-2017-16818 CVE-2018-7262 Affected Products: openSUSE Leap 42.3 ______________________________________________________________________________ An update that solves two vulnerabilities and has 21 fixes is now available. Description: This update for ceph fixes the following issues: Security issues fixed: - CVE-2018-7262: rgw: malformed http headers can crash rgw (bsc#1081379). - CVE-2017-16818: User reachable asserts allow for DoS (bsc#1063014). Bug fixes: - bsc#1061461: OSDs keep generating coredumps after adding new OSD node to cluster. - bsc#1079076: RGW openssl fixes. - bsc#1067088: Upgrade to SES5 restarted all nodes, majority of OSDs aborts during start. - bsc#1056125: Some OSDs are down when doing performance testing on rbd image in EC Pool. - bsc#1087269: allow_ec_overwrites option not in command options list. - bsc#1051598: Fix mountpoint check for systemctl enable --runtime. - bsc#1070357: Zabbix mgr module doesn't recover from HEALTH_ERR. - bsc#1066502: After upgrading a single OSD from SES 4 to SES 5 the OSDs do not rejoin the cluster. - bsc#1067119: Crushtool decompile creates wrong device entries (device 20 device20) for not existing / deleted OSDs. - bsc#1060904: Loglevel misleading during keystone authentication. - bsc#1056967: Monitors goes down after pool creation on cluster with120 OSDs. - bsc#1067705: Issues with RGW Multi-Site Federation between SES5 and RH Ceph Storage 2. - bsc#1059458: Stopping / restarting rados gateway as part of deepsea stage.4 executions causes core-dump of radosgw. - bsc#1087493: Commvault cannot reconnect to storage after restarting haproxy. - bsc#1066182: Container synchronization between two Ceph clusters failed. - bsc#1081600: Crash in civetweb/RGW. - bsc#1054061: NFS-GANESHA service failing while trying to list mountpoint on client. - bsc#1074301: OSDs keep aborting: SnapMapper failed asserts. - bsc#1086340: XFS metadata corruption on rbd-nbd mapped image with journaling feature enabled. - bsc#1080788: fsid mismatch when creating additional OSDs. - bsc#1071386: Metadata spill onto block.slow. This update was imported from the SUSE:SLE-12-SP3:Update update project. Patch Instructions: To install this openSU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ch". Debian 8: DSA-3743-2 Moderate: Python-Bottle Header Crash Fix

The update for python-bottle issued as DSA-3743-1 would cause a crash if a unicode string was used as a header. Updated packages are now available to correct this issue. For the stable distribution (jessie), this problem has been fixed in version 0.12.7-1+deb8u2. We recommend that you upgrade your python-bottle packages.
